What is Automation in Smart Shops?

Automation in smart shops refers to technological solutions designed to streamline workflows, reduce manual tasks, and enhance the overall shopping experience. This includes a range of technologies from self-checkout kiosks to inventory management systems integrated with AI. The goal is to improve efficiency, lower operational costs, and provide a seamless customer experience.

One compelling statistic underscores the growth of automation: a study by McKinsey shows that automation could eliminate 30% of hours worked in retail by 2030. This trend is being driven by consumer expectations for faster and more personalized service. Smart shops are adopting automation technologies to meet these demands while staying competitive in an increasingly crowded retail landscape.

Benefits of Automation: Enhancing Operations and Customer Experiences

Implementing automation in smart shops leads to significant operational advantages. For example, retailers report reductions in labor costs, increased accuracy in inventory management, and improved customer satisfaction. By automating routine tasks, employees can focus on decision-making and customer service, which enhances the value proposition for customers.

Moreover, automation technologies facilitate a more personalized shopping experience. Smart shops are leveraging data analytics to tailor services according to individual customer preferences. For instance, automated recommendation engines analyze purchase histories to suggest relevant products, making the shopping journey more engaging. According to Salesforce, 70% of consumers express a preference for purchasing from brands that offer personalized experiences. This not only boosts sales but also fosters customer loyalty.

How to Implement Automation in Your Smart Shop: A Step-by-Step Guide

  1. Assess Your Current Operations: Identify tasks that are time-consuming and prone to error. This could involve inventory management, customer service, or checkout processes.
  2. Research Relevant Technologies: Look for solutions that align with your operational needs. Options might include AI-driven chatbots for customer service, automated stock replenishment, or mobile payment systems.
  3. Pilot Testing: Before a full rollout, conduct pilot testing to evaluate the effectiveness of selected automation tools. Engage employees in the process for feedback.
  4. Training Staff: Invest in proper training for your team to ensure they can effectively use new technologies. Employee adaptability is crucial for successful automation.
  5. Monitor Performance: After implementation, continuously monitor performance metrics to measure efficiency gains and customer satisfaction.

Through effective implementation, smart shops can seamlessly integrate automation into their operations, optimizing both workflow and customer experiences.

Comparing Automation Options: What Works Best for Your Smart Shop?

When evaluating different automation technologies, it’s vital to consider their strengths and weaknesses. The table below compares three common automation solutions used in smart shops:

FeatureSelf-Checkout SystemsAI-Driven Inventory ManagementMobile Payment Solutions
User-FriendlinessHigh (Intuitive interface)Moderate (Requires setup)High (Familiar technology)
Cost of ImplementationModerate (Initial investment)High (Complex integration)Low (Minimal setup costs)
Operational EfficiencyHigh (Saves labor costs)High (Reduces stockouts)Moderate (Speeds up checkout)
Customer SatisfactionHigh (Faster service)Moderate (Less stock issues)High (Convenience of payment)
The comparison highlights that while **self-checkout systems** excel in enhancing user experience and reducing labor, **AI-driven inventory management** solutions are pivotal in maintaining stock accuracy. Depending on your specific needs, combining these technologies may yield even greater efficiencies.

As we move further into 2026, several trends in the automation of smart shops are emerging. One notable trend is the increased integration of Internet of Things (IoT) devices, allowing for real-time data collection and analysis. For instance, smart shelves can track inventory levels and notify management of replenishment needs automatically, significantly streamlining operations.

Additionally, the shift towards a contactless shopping experience is becoming more prevalent. Innovations such as mobile scanning apps or biometric payment systems are gaining traction as consumers prefer safer and more convenient payment methods. The ongoing pandemic has accelerated this trend, driving smart shops to prioritize hygiene while enhancing customer experience.

Finally, sustainability is increasingly influencing automation choices in smart shops. Many retailers are focusing on energy-efficient solutions that not only reduce operational costs but also appeal to environmentally conscious consumers. According to a report from Statista, 55% of consumers are willing to change their shopping habits to reduce environmental impact, driving smart shops to adopt greener technologies.
